Lakshadweep Diplomacy: Israel's Collaboration in Regional Development

Introduction 

In the midst of diplomatic turbulence between India and the Maldives, Israel has emerged as a key player in the development trajectory of India's Lakshadweep islands. The recent announcement of Israel's collaboration with India to initiate a water desalination project in Lakshadweep underscores a complex web of geopolitical dynamics and regional interests.



Background of the Diplomatic Rift

The genesis of the diplomatic friction can be traced back to derogatory remarks made by a now-suspended Maldivian deputy minister against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i. The comments, labeling PM Modi as a 'puppet of Israel,' ignited a diplomatic row between India and the Maldives, tarnishing the bilateral relations between the two nations.


Israeli Interest in Lakshadweep

Against this backdrop, Israel's interest in Lakshadweep's development and its eagerness to collaborate with India signal a strategic maneuver in the region. The Israeli embassy in India has expressed a keen interest in promoting Lakshadweep's tourism potential, highlighting the pristine beaches and marine life that adorn the archipelago.


Last year, upon the Indian government's request, Israel conducted a visit to Lakshadweep and showcased its readiness to embark on a water desalination program, a crucial step in addressing the region's water scarcity issues. This proactive engagement underscores Israel's strategic interests in the Indian Ocean region and its commitment to fostering ties with India.


Diplomatic Repercussions and Responses

The disparaging remarks made by the Maldivian ministers prompted swift diplomatic responses from India. The Maldivian envoy was summoned by India's external affairs ministry, expressing strong reservations over the derogatory comments aimed at PM Modi. Subsequently, three Maldivian deputy ministers faced suspension for their social media posts criticizing PM Modi and questioning India's promotion of Lakshadweep over the Maldives as a tourist destination.


In response to the diplomatic fallout, the Maldivian foreign ministry sought to distance itself from the derogatory comments, emphasizing that the personal views expressed on social media do not reflect the official stance of the country.


President Mohamed Muizzu has a history of pro-China and anti-India policies, something which was very evident in his campaign promises and statements which demanded the removal of Indian troops from the Island nation. A diplomatic standoff has been in place with India ever since his appointment to power in November 2023. 


Israel's Diplomatic Engagement

Israel's diplomatic foray into the Lakshadweep development narrative has been multifaceted. While the cooperative engagement between India and Israel in water management, particularly desalination technology, has been a focal point, the broader geopolitical implications cannot be overlooked.


The Israeli embassy's active participation in promoting the #ExploreIndianIslands trend on social media, coupled with its showcasing of Lakshadweep's natural splendor, underscores Israel's strategic alignment with India and its vested interest in the region's development.


Impact on Tourism and Regional Dynamics

The diplomatic imbroglio has had ripple effects on regional tourism and travel dynamics. PM Modi's recent visit to Lakshadweep and his subsequent social media posts advocating for the exploration of Indian islands received mixed reactions, particularly from Maldives ministers. The suspension of Maldivian officials and the ensuing #BoycottMaldives campaign on social media underscore the intricacies of regional politics and the interconnectedness of diplomatic relations and tourism dynamics.


Reports of cancellations to the Maldives amid the diplomatic tensions highlight the economic ramifications of such rifts in bilateral relations. However, the concerted efforts by Indian celebrities and the Israeli embassy to promote Lakshadweep's tourism potential signify a broader narrative of regional collaboration and development.
